VZ Hedge Fund Activity: Q2 2018 in Review

2,147 of the 4,369 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Verizon (VZ) for Q2 2018, worth a combined $135B — up 5.2% from $128B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 129 funds opened new VZ positions and 84 closed out — a net gain of 45 holders — while 930 added to existing stakes and 903 trimmed.

The largest buyer was JP Morgan Chase, adding an estimated $875M. The largest seller was Capital Research Global Investors, cutting an estimated $1.06B.
